What I really like about Zen Cho is the dialogue and weird language games that come of moving lightly and sharply between language and dialect, and as a result I don't like this series as much, because the Regency-reminiscent posturing kills that. It's still a good little adventure story. Everyone has a good time. Occasionally the upper crust Britishness goes a bit twee, but it feels like you're in on the joke. It's not *as good*, but it's good.
